Why Are Blade Size and Type Crucial for Corded Miter Saw Efficiency?
Blade size and type are crucial for corded miter saw efficiency because they directly impact the saw’s cutting capability and accuracy. The right blade ensures swift cuts, reduces material waste, and enhances safety.
According to the American National Standards Institute (ANSI), blade specifications, including size and type, are key factors in determining the performance of tools like miter saws. ANSI provides standards to ensure that tools operate safely and effectively.
The efficiency of a corded miter saw depends on the size of the blade, which determines the depth and width of cuts. A larger blade can cut thicker materials, while a smaller blade is suited for finer, more detailed work. The type of blade—such as crosscut, rip, or combination blades—also influences the quality of the cut. For instance, crosscut blades typically have more teeth, resulting in smoother cuts on wood across the grain.
Technical terms include “kerf” and “tooth count.” Kerf refers to the width of the cut made by the blade, while tooth count refers to the number of teeth on the blade. A lower tooth count means faster cutting, while a higher tooth count provides smoother finishes.
The mechanism of cutting involves the rotation of the blade at high speed, allowing it to slice through material using its sharp teeth. Each tooth removes a small amount of material with each rotation, creating a clean cut. The blade’s design, including hook angle and tooth shape, affects the cutting action and speed.
Specific conditions that contribute to miter saw efficiency include using the correct blade for the material. For example, a carbide-tipped blade is ideal for cutting hardwoods, while a steel blade works well for softer woods. A worn-out or damaged blade can lead to inefficient cutting and increased friction, potentially causing overheating.

Sliding Miter Saws:
Sliding miter saws offer enhanced cutting capacity by utilizing rails that allow the saw blade to move forward and backward. This feature significantly increases the maximum width of the cut and offers more versatility when working with larger pieces of wood or other materials. For example, a 12-inch sliding miter saw can cut wider materials than a standard fixed saw, making it suitable for the construction of furniture or large baseboards. According to a study by Woodworking Network, professionals often prefer sliding miter saws for their ability to handle extensive molding and framing tasks efficiently. -
Dual Bevel Miter Saws:
Dual bevel miter saws excel at making bevel cuts in both directions, which prevents users from needing to flip the workpiece to complete tasks. This feature is particularly beneficial when making angled cuts for projects like crown molding, where accuracy is paramount. A report from Fine Homebuilding states that users save considerable time with dual bevel saws since adjustments and repositioning are minimized, resulting in greater efficiency on time-sensitive jobs. -
Compound Miter Saws:
Compound miter saws are designed to handle simple miter and bevel cuts effectively. Their straightforward operation makes them ideal for tasks like cutting crown molding, window casings, or baseboards. This saw type combines flexibility with user-friendliness, appealing to both beginners and seasoned professionals. A comparison by This Old House highlights the popularity of compound miter saws among DIY enthusiasts for home improvement projects due to their ability to make precise cuts without extensive setups.

Blade Guard:
The blade guard functions as a protective cover that shields users from the saw blade during operation. This feature minimizes accidental contact with the blade, reducing the risk of serious injury. A properly designed blade guard automatically retracts when making a cut and returns to its position afterward. Many modern miter saws, such as the DeWalt DWS780, include advanced blade guards for increased safety. -
Electric Brake:
The electric brake quickly stops the rotation of the saw blade after the trigger is released. This feature prevents accidents by reducing the time the blade remains in motion, which is crucial for safety, especially in a bustling workshop setting. According to a 2021 safety report by the American National Standards Institute (ANSI), saws equipped with electric brakes demonstrate a significant reduction in injury rates. -
Safety Switch:
The safety switch helps to prevent accidental startups. It requires a two-step process to operate the saw, which can include pressing a button or lever in addition to pulling the trigger. This feature is particularly beneficial for users who may be working in hurried or distracted environments. Implementing a safety switch can greatly diminish risks in a busy workspace. -
